Buying Guide: How to Choose the Best Beer Glasses Sets?
Why beer glass shape actually matters
Glass shape changes how you experience beer in three specific ways. First, the bowl shape traps or releases aroma compounds, which is where most of what you actually taste comes from. Second, the rim width controls how the beer hits your palate. Third, the glass can maintain or kill head retention, which affects both aroma and mouthfeel.
Professional cicerones estimate you miss a significant portion of a beer’s character when you drink from a can or the wrong glass. This is not snobbery. It is sensory physics.
Types of beer glasses explained
Pint glasses come in two main styles. The American shaker pint is the straight-sided default you see in most bars. The British nonic pint has a slight bulge near the top for grip and stacking. Both are versatile but do little for aroma.
Tulip glasses have a wide bowl that flares out and a rim that curves slightly inward. This shape traps aromatics and supports a thick head. Tulips are excellent for Belgian ales, IPAs, and aromatic stouts.
Pilsner glasses are tall and slender, designed to show off the color and carbonation of light lagers. The shape keeps bubbles rising and the head intact.
IPA glasses typically have a ridged base that creates nucleation for continuous bubbles, with a bowl that captures hop aromas. Spiegelau and Rastal make the most respected versions.
Wheat beer glasses are tall and curvy, with a narrow base that widens in the middle and narrows again at the top. The shape supports the thick, fluffy head characteristic of hefeweizens.
Snifters have a short stem and a wide bowl that narrows at the top. They are designed for high-ABV beers like imperial stouts and barleywines, where you want to capture intense aromas.
Goblets and chalices are wide-bowled, often stemmed, and built for sipping. Belgian breweries have signature chalice shapes designed for their specific beers.
Steins and mugs are heavy, often with handles, built for volume drinking. The handle keeps your warm hand off the glass, and the thick walls can hold freezer cold for a frosted pour.
Dishwasher versus hand wash
Dishwasher-safe glassware is a real convenience, but be honest with yourself about how you will actually clean your glasses. Many premium glasses are technically dishwasher safe but look better and last longer with hand washing. Heated dry cycles can etch glass over time, and detergent can slowly cloud crystal.
For everyday pint glasses, dishwasher safety is a reasonable requirement. For premium tulip and crystal glasses, plan to hand wash if you want them to look new for years.
Freezer compatibility and temperature retention
Freezer-safe glasses let you pull a frosted vessel out for hot weather pours. Thick glass holds cold well, but be careful with extreme temperature swings. Pouring a room-temperature beer into a freezer-cold glass can shock thin glass.
For dedicated freezer storage, look for thick-walled mugs and steins. The GOSDENG mugs and PARNOO pints in this guide are both freezer-rated and tested.
Double-walled insulated glasses like the Host FREEZE take a different approach, using cooling gel sealed between walls. These keep beer cold longer than a frozen glass but are usually plastic rather than glass.

Matching glass to beer style
Here is a quick reference for matching common glass shapes to beer styles. Pint glasses work for casual drinking of most styles. Tulip glasses shine with Belgian ales, IPAs, stouts, and any aromatic beer. Pilsner glasses are purpose-built for pilsners and helles lagers. Wheat beer glasses are essential for hefeweizens and witbiers. Snifters are ideal for imperial stouts, barleywines, and strong ales. Steins and mugs work for any lager you want to drink cold and fast.
If you only own one style of specialty glass, make it a tulip. It is the most versatile aromatic glass and works for the widest range of beer styles.
Frequently Asked Questions About Beer Glasses
What are the different types of beer glasses?
The main types of beer glasses include pint glasses (American shaker and British nonic), tulip glasses, pilsner glasses, IPA glasses, wheat beer glasses, snifters, goblets and chalices, and steins or mugs. Each shape is designed to enhance specific beer styles through aroma capture, head retention, and temperature control.
Do different style beer glasses make a difference in the beer’s taste?
Yes, glass shape noticeably affects flavor and aroma. Tulip and IPA glasses trap volatile aroma compounds at the rim, which is where most of what you taste actually comes from. Pilsner glasses maintain carbonation and head, while wide-bowl snifters concentrate aromas from high-ABV beers. Professional cicerones confirm that drinking from the correct glass enhances the beer experience significantly.
How many ounces are in an average beer glass?
A standard American pint glass holds 16 ounces. British imperial pints hold 20 ounces. Common craft beer glasses range from 11 to 16 ounces, with tulip and IPA glasses typically around 15 to 16 ounces. Snifters and high-ABV glasses often hold less, around 10 to 12 ounces, because strong beers are served in smaller portions.
Does beer stay colder in glass?
Glass generally maintains cold temperature better than metal or plastic because it has thermal mass. Thick glass, especially when chilled in the freezer, keeps beer cold for extended periods. Double-walled insulated glasses with cooling gel, like the Host FREEZE, keep beer coldest longest. Stemmed glasses also help by keeping your warm hand away from the bowl.
